The Bombardier BD-100-1A10 Challenger 300 family occupies the mid-size business jet niche, offering a combination of transcontinental range, comfortable eight-passenger executive seating, and a 45,000 ft service ceiling. Powerplants from the Honeywell HTF7000 family deliver performance figures consistent with the platform’s mission set, while Pro Line 21 avionics remain a common and supportable fit for operators prioritizing classical integrated flight decks. For buyers and charter operators assessing examples like N31CA, key market considerations include engine program status, avionics upgrades, and interior refurbishment, which materially affect maintenance planning and resale prospects for a 2004-build Challenger 300.
